The Ashtavakra Gita is a revered spiritual text that has been a guiding light for seekers of truth and self-realization for centuries. This ancient Indian scripture is a dialogue between the sage Ashtavakra and King Janaka, who is also a seeker of truth. The text is a profound exploration of the nature of the self, reality, and the path to liberation.
